What is the main goal of a marketing strategy informed by data?

The primary aim of a marketing strategy driven by data is to tailor campaigns based on insights. This approach leverages data analysis to understand consumer behavior, preferences, and market trends, enabling marketers to create more personalized and effective campaigns. By analyzing data, businesses can identify specific customer segments, understand their needs, and craft messages that resonate with those individuals. This customization enhances engagement and conversion rates, leading to better overall marketing performance and a higher return on investment.

In contrast, adhering to traditional marketing methods can limit the effectiveness of campaigns, as these methods may not fully account for changing consumer dynamics. Making decisions without data analysis often leads to guesswork, which can result in inefficient allocation of resources. Lastly, promoting a single audience segment restricts the reach and potential of a marketing strategy, as it ignores the diverse needs of different consumer groups that could benefit from tailored messaging. Thus, focusing on insights derived from data provides a comprehensive foundation for successful marketing strategies.
